A New Beginning...



Well, here we are... I finally succumb to a much needed tank upgrade... I purchased a system from a local reefer on 06-14-09... I have been thinking about the tank upgrade for more than a year... I'm glad I finally did... Pls join me on this journey...

- Tank Specs -
Tank: 110g Tank (48" x 24" x 22") with custom made stand and canopy; 34g sump in the stand
Lighting: (6) 48" T5 Retros... middle 4 bulbs are overdriven w/ IceCap Ballast; 2 outside bulbs are normal output
Skimmer: MSX 200
Pump/Powerhead: Mag 9.5 for return & Vortech MP40 (from 28g JBJ)
Controller: Reef Keeper Elite
Top Off: Tunze Osmolator (from 28g JBJ)
Birthday: 06-14-09

Fish List: to be determined... but the tank will be Fairy Wrasse dominated...
Coral List: favorite 25 z's & p's, chalices... it'll be a mixed reef tank but z's & p's dominated...

Original Mummy Eye Chalice


The Original Mummy Eye Chalice was my only chalice for a long time... I received my very first frag from whodah at exoticfrags.us... I was fortunate enough to receive a frag way before it was released to the public... unfortunately, when I moved to our house in Nov 2007, I lost my original frag/mini colony... on July 2008, I was able to acquire another frag, also with lineaged to whodah so I know it's the original one... it has been growing nicely ever since... a friend came by to do the first frag session in Feb 2009... this was one of the most expensive frag sessions ever, when I say expensive, I mean my losses... never put freshly cut chalice on med-high flow & med-high light... that is a recipe for disaster in my experience... we made about 8-9 frags and 5-6 frags were dead in 1-2 weeks... we managed to save a few frags and the main colony is starting to grow again so at least that's good news... anyway, the picture above is on her glory days, just a few days before going under the blade...

Hybrid PPE's


One of the most sought after paly in the market is the PPE paly. Characteristics of a PPE are deep purple, bright green skirts, and bright green slit. Now with the Hybrid PPE's, the difference is the whitish/grayish splatter in the center. A truly awesome PE morph. This is the first time I've seen this PE morph since I started collecting zoas and palys in 2005.
